Before starting a home business you need to understand what is real and what is a scam. You must do your homework. Internet is great for finding anything, including getting the facts about any business opportunities.
1. Seeking information about a company before entering. Look for complaints, investigations or misleading information about the products.
2. Try to get a friend for their opinion about a company, not to join with you but only to help you make a decision.
3. Talk to people who are familiar with a company that you are interested in. What sets the company apart from the rest?
4. Check with the Better Business Bureau and the Chamber of Commerce. How long has the company been in business? Search for any news on the
company, good or bad.
5. What product do they offer? It 's extremely important that the product is reasonably priced and a consumable. The product can be ordered and consumed every month? Would a customer want to order and consume every month?
6. Stay away from companies that need to stock inventory. Finding a company that only requires the purchase of enough products for a month at a time.
7. Avoid the use of start-up costs. They are usually a sign that a company is just trying to make a profit and not to provide a useful, quality product. Think about it, why should you pay an outrageous sum to start a business? What purpose would serve if not to give someone else your money?
8. What is necessary before entering a check? Make sure you understand how you will be paid and what is necessary for you to get paid before you start.
9. The company provides support and training? The support is very important, you need help and you need training. Who is your sponsor? How long have they been with the company and provide the support necessary to succeed?
10. Is there a refund policy?
11. Your compensation should be based on the purchase of a product by a customer. If you can not understand what the product, then avoid that company.
12. Before signing on the dotted line talk with others in the industry to see what they have to say about the company and the compensation plan.
Remember that all good things take time and patience. If you plan your business before beginning then your chances of success are more then just jumping on the first occasion that you meet.
